Subtract 2/20 from 25/60
25/60 - 2/20 is 19/60.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 60 and 20 is 60
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 60 - For the 1st fraction, since 60 × 1 = 60,
25/60 = 25 × 1/60 × 1 = 25/60 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 20 × 3 = 60,
2/20 = 2 × 3/20 × 3 = 6/60 - Subtract the two like fractions:
25/60 - 6/60 = 25 - 6/60 = 19/60
